The location
Heraklion is the largest city in Crete and the main arrival point for the island. Staying in the city gives access to the Heraklion Archaeological Museum, the covered market, Knossos (15 minutes by bus), and the E75 road that connects Crete east and west.
The city centre has a genuine local restaurant and café scene — distinct from the resort strip east of the airport.
Nearby
- Heraklion Archaeological Museum: In the city centre
- Knossos: 15 minutes by local bus
- Phaistos: About 50 minutes by car
- Archanes village: 15 minutes south by car
- North coast beaches: 10–20 minutes by car
